Webgo back on (something) To not do something one said one would do; to renege on something. People are beginning to worry that the president is going to go back on his campaign promises. You made a commitment to support our project, and now you've gone back on your word! This issue is hardly new. It goes way back to when the company was first founded. 2. expression Said when one has known someone for a very long time. Oh, Caitlin and I go way back—we've been friends since kindergarten, in fact! See also: back, go, way
